ACTIVITY ON WORK, POWER AND CALC.
Please do the following activity:
- Find the work done by a man if he carries 60kg up, to a distance of 3m.
- A boy pushes by applying a force of 5N. Find the work done by this force as the book is displaced through 20cm along the push.
- A man has been guarding a house for one hour. Why is it not considered work in science?
- Name two sources of sound.
- Why does a person standing for a long time get tired when he does not appear to do any work?
- Differentiate between force and work?
- Define work and write its unit.
- When you rub your palms together, they feel hot indicating that work-done against friction involved converting mechanical energy into _______ energy.
- A boy pushes a load of mass 10kg to a distance of 20metres in 10seconds. Calculate:
a) The work done
b) The boy’s power
Take g = 10 m/s2
